, /PRNewswire/ -- Robbins Geller Rudman & Dowd LLP announces that purchasers or acquirers of AeroVironment, Inc. (NASDAQ: AVAV) securities between June 25, 2025 and March 10, 2026, inclusive (the "Class Period"), have until Monday, July 27, 2026 to seek appointment as lead plaintiff of the AeroVironment class action lawsuit. Captioned Norrell v. AeroVironment, Inc., No. 26-cv-01429 (E.D. Va.), the AeroVironment class action lawsuit charges AeroVironment as well as certain of AeroVironment's current and former executive officers with violations of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934.If you suffered substantial losses and wish to serve as lead plaintiff of the AeroVironment class action lawsuit, please provide your information here: https://www.rgrdlaw.com/cases-aerovironment-class-action-lawsuit-avav.html You can also contact attorneys Ken Dolitsky or Michael Albert of Robbins Geller by calling 800/851-7783 or via e-mail at [email protected]. CASE ALLEGATIONS: AeroVironment designs, develops, produces, delivers, and supports a portfolio of robotic systems and related services for government agencies and businesses. The AeroVironment class action lawsuit alleges on May 1, 2025, AeroVironment announced it had completed the acquisition of BlueHalo, LLC, which had previously been awarded a contract to support the U.S. Space Force's Satellite Communication Augmentation Resource ("SCAR") program. The SCAR program represents the U.S. Space Force's efforts to modernize antennas used by the Satellite Control Network ("SCN"), which is comprised of 19 fixed antennas across the world and executes tasks such as tracking satellites, transmitting signals, and conducting telemetry, or accessing data from satellites to assess their status and health, according to the complaint. The AeroVironment class action lawsuit alleges that defendants throughout the Class Period made false and/or misleading statements and/or failed to disclose that: (i) AeroVironment understated the likelihood that it would imminently face competition from other vendors for the work it performed in connection with the SCAR program and the U.S. Space Force's ongoing efforts to modernize the SCN; and (ii) accordingly, defendants overstated AeroVironment's business and financial prospects. The AeroVironment class action lawsuit further alleges that on January 20, 2026, AeroVironment announced that the U.S. government had issued a stop work order on AeroVironment's agreement to deliver BADGER systems to the SCAR program. In the same announcement, AeroVironment allegedly stated that the stop work order "allows for the parties to negotiate an amended agreement for the future of the SCAR program" and that "[t]he Company expects to continue to deliver capabilities and products for the SCAR program." On this news, the price of AeroVironment stock fell nearly 16%, according to the complaint. Then, on March 2, 2026, SpaceNews allegedly reported that the U.S. Space Force was reopening the SCAR program and "reassessing how to move forward." Space News quoted Colonel Owen Stevens, director of contracting at the Space Rapid Capabilities Office, which supervised SCAR, as stating: "We have been in conversations with the SAE [senior acquisition executive] for a little while now, and we are going to move into a new acquisition strategy for SCAR," the complaint alleges. On this news, the price of AeroVironment stock fell more than 17%, according to the complaint. Finally, on March 10, 2026, the complaint alleges that AeroVironment announced its financial results for the third quarter of fiscal year 2026. Among other items, AeroVironment allegedly reported a third-quarter operating loss of $179.0 million, compared to an operating loss of $3.1 million for the same period in fiscal year 2025. These financial results reflected the impact of a $151.3 million goodwill impairment in AeroVironment's space division after the stop work order on AeroVironment's BADGER systems built for the SCAR program, according to the AeroVironment class action lawsuit. AeroVironment also allegedly reported that the U.S. Space Force had terminated AeroVironment's contract concerning the SCAR program, and as a result, it would have to "recompete" for the SCAR program. On this news, the price of AeroVironment stock fell more than 6%, the complaint alleges. (CSE: MSM) (OTCQB: MSMMF) (FSE: E9Z) ("Metalsource" or the "Company") is pleased to announce the results of a recently completed induced polarization ("IP") survey designed to identify drill targets on strike from the historic Silver Hill mine. The survey identified approximately 2.4 kilometres of prospective strike length across two primary target areas, including a continuous 1.8 kilometre anomaly in the southern portion of the project area, in the immediate vicinity of Silver Hill, and an additional 600 metre IP anomaly in the northeast corner of the property.These IP data and recent drilling results continue to validate Metalsource's exploration thesis that mineralization remains open in all directions, and there are significant opportunities to add scale to the mineralization discovered thus far through on strike and down dip exploration drilling. Key Highlights Phase 2 IP survey identifies approximately 2.4 kilometres of prospective target areas across the Silver Hill district.High priority drill targets display geophysical characteristics analogous to the mineralized corridor defined by recent drilling.Targets remain open north and south of the historic mine, significantly expanding the Company's exploration pipeline.Results strengthen management's evolving geological model that Silver Hill may comprise multiple mineralized occurrences rather than a single historic deposit.Company advancing plans to increase drilling capacity to simultaneously expand known mineralization and systematically test newly identified targets. Figure 1: Plan view showing the extent of recently completed ground IP Survey. Right: Unfiltered polarization results. Left: Polarization results filtered to 20-35 msec to show anomalous trend. Note Project focus area includes the Silver Hill mine and a significant portion of the companies property position. To view an enhanced version of this graphic, please visit: https://images.newsfilecorp.com/files/12035/305405_90115bf674546854_002full.jpg Figure 2: Plan view showing resistivity results from ground IP survey with anomalous polarization data (points). Coincident polarization anomalies (20-35msec) with >1,500Ωm resistivity results is an exploration target. Note: Non-target resistivities removed for clarity on the right side of the image. To view an enhanced version of this graphic, please visit: https://images.newsfilecorp.com/files/12035/305405_90115bf674546854_003full.jpg High-Grade Drilling Validates IP Targeting Model Exploration drilling completed to date at Silver Hill has demonstrated significant metal endowment within the Company's target horizon. Drilling has so far identified mineralization in up to 18 metres of drill core, and composite assay results of up to 209 g/t gold, 241 g/t silver, 18.8% lead, 39.4% zinc, and 5.4% copper (Table 1). The consistency of this polymetallic mineralization has established Silver Hill as an excellent candidate for electrical geophysics and provided the foundation for the Company's evolving exploration model. At Silver Hill, the combination of IP chargeability and resistivity data provides two complementary and independently interpretable signals. Elevated chargeability values (greater than 20 milliseconds) are interpreted to potentially reflect the presence of metallic sulphide minerals, while resistivity distinguishes the silicified host of the mineralization (1,500 to 4,000 ohm-m) from both the conductive weathered saprolite at surface and the highly resistive volcanic package, which exceeds 5,000 ohm-m. This two parameter discrimination allows geophysically anomalous zones to be ranked not only by their sulphide content, but also by their host rock environment, enabling the identification of interpreted mineralization occurring at the favourable contact between volcanic flows and the underlying silicified host rocks. Metalsource QA/QC protocols are maintained through the insertion of certified reference material (standards), blanks, and duplicates within the sample stream. The drill core is cut in half with a diamond saw, with one half placed in sealed bags and shipped to the laboratory and the other half retained on site. Chain of custody is maintained from the drill to the submittal into the laboratory preparation facility. Analytical testing is performed by ALS Geochemistry (Reno, NV) and ALS Canada (Vancouver, BC). The entire sample is crushed to 70% passing 2mm mesh, with a 250 gram split pulverized to 85% passing minus 75 micron. A four-acid digest is performed on 0.25g of sample to quantitatively dissolve most geological materials. Analysis is performed with a combination of ICP-AES and ICP-MS and fire assay. The exploration results described herein are preliminary in nature and are insufficient to define a mineral resource. Further drilling is required to determine the continuity, geometry, and grade distribution of mineralization. At the time of this release analytical results remain pending. *Metal values used in AgEq calculations are from the 200-day moving average values from 2/6/2026, and all values are in USD. PAu= $124.5/g, PAg= $1.58/g, PCu= $4.9/lbs, PPb=$0.90/lbs, PZn=$1.11/lbs, 0.00220462262 = grams-to-pounds conversion factor, 22.0462262 = pounds per tonne for 1% metal. Metal recoveries used in the AgEq calculation are Au: 95.5%, Ag: 92.9%, Pb: 89.2%, Zn: 93.8% and Cu 90.8%. These recovery values are derived from batch metallurgical testing used to estimate recoveries of Silver Hill ores, completed in 1988. Individual metal values in the results table are composited values and not factored by recovery. Metal recoveries are applied to their respective component of the AgEq calculation only. Silver Hill Project Located in the Carolina Terrane, the property is underlain by volcaniclastic and volcano-sedimentary rocks predominantly of Neoproterozoic and Cambrian age. Current interpretations suggest this terrane is an extension of the Avalon Terrane. The property is 1,225 acres located in Davidson County, North Carolina. As the first significant discovery and first silver-producing mine in America, the property is supported by an extensive historic dataset, including drillhole data, underground mapping, historic dumps and underground chip samples. Currently known mineralization extends to 550m from surface, in a steeply trending series of lenses, which remain open in multiple directions. Byrd-Pilot Mountain Project The Byrd-Pilot Mountain Project is located in central North Carolina within the Carolina Terrane. Initial USGS surveys in the 1980s identified the area as a potential host for a porphyry gold-copper system. Subsequent exploration demonstrated broad gold mineralization in soils, trenches, and shallow RC drilling, coincident with strong self-potential anomalies. Geology shows intense quartz-sericite-pyrite alteration, high-sulfidation signatures, and high-alumina minerals (like Haile and Brewer deposits to the south), suggesting potential for a large epithermal or porphyry-related gold system. Geologic modelling of currently identified mineralization indicates an east-west trend open in multiple directions, with oxidation noted down to a depth of 30m. No drilling has tested the Meridian discovery zone since those 1980s campaigns, leaving potential for significant resource expansion through work commitments of the agreement. –12-Month Data Demonstrated Sustained Improvement with TPIP Across All Secondary Efficacy Measures Including Reduction in Mortality Risk Status by REVEAL Lite 2.0––Placebo Crossed Group Demonstrated Treatment Response on TPIP, Achieving Similar Outcomes to the TPIP Continued Group by Month 12– –TPIP Was Safe and Well-tolerated with No Newly Identified Safety Signals through Month 12; Doses Up to 1,280 µg Once Daily Were Permitted in the OLE Study– –These OLE Data, Combined with Once-Daily Inhaled Administration, Reinforce TPIP's Potential to Become the Prostanoid of Choice for Patients with PAH– –Insmed to Host Investor Call Thursday, July 16, 2026, at 8:00 a.m. ET– , /PRNewswire/ -- Insmed Incorporated (Nasdaq: INSM), a people-first global biopharmaceutical company striving to deliver first- and best-in-class therapies to transform the lives of patients facing serious diseases, today announced positive 12-Month data from the ongoing open-label extension (OLE) study evaluating treprostinil palmitil inhalation powder (TPIP), administered once daily in pat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H, World Health Organization Group 1). The OLE study is a non-placebo-controlled trial and was designed to evaluate the long-term safety, tolerability, and effectiveness of TPIP over 24 months in patients who completed the lead-in TPIP PAH studies. "These data from our ongoing OLE study with TPIP represent an important milestone in our efforts to fully harness the potential of treprostinil and provide meaningful benefit to pat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ension," said Gene Sullivan, M.D., Chief Product Strategy Officer of Insmed. "In this analysis, TPIP demonstrated sustained improvement across all efficacy endpoints and was well tolerated with no newly identified safety signals, and notably, patients who switched from placebo to TPIP in the OLE study achieved similar clinical benefit. These data, coupled with the statistically significant and clinically meaningful results from our Phase 2b randomized study, demonstrate TPIP's potential to become the prostanoid of choice for PAH patients, and we remain excited to be advancing our Phase 3 PALM-PAH study." 12-Month Results from the Ongoing OLE Study with TPIP in Patients with PAH Results for secondary efficacy endpoints demonstrated sustained improvement with TPIP in six-minute walk distance (6MWD), N-terminal fragment pro-B-type natriuretic peptide (NT-proBNP) concentration, and World Health Organization (WHO) Functional Class, as well as a clinically meaningful improvement in REVEAL Lite 2.0 score at Month 12. Patients in the Placebo Crossed group (N=31) showed similar outcomes to patients in the TPIP Continued group (N=60) across all efficacy measures at Month 12. The results at Month 12 were as follows: Mean improvement from baseline for 6MWD was +55.7 meters for the TPIP Continued group and +54.1 meters for the Placebo Crossed group. NT-proBNP concentration was reduced by approximately 60% in both groups with geometric mean ratios [GMR] to baseline of 0.40 and 0.41 in TPIP Continued and Placebo Crossed, respectively. WHO Functional Class I or II was achieved in 78.3% of TPIP Continued group and 80.6% of Placebo Crossed group patients, and more than 25% of patients across both groups achieved WHO Functional Class I. Mean REVEAL Lite 2.0 score improved 2.0-points from baseline for the TPIP Continued group and 1.4-points from baseline for the Placebo Crossed group. Approximately 65% of all patients achieved Refined Low Risk status, which is associated with a less than 5% estimated risk of mortality at three years and an approximately 7% risk of clinical worsening at one year. "Pulmonary arterial hypertension is one of the most devastating diseases we face as clinicians, and these results from the ongoing TPIP OLE study give us genuine reason for optimism," said Dr. Raymond Benza, M.D., F.A.C.C., FAHA, FACP, Phase 2b PAH study Steering Committee Member, George M. and Linda H. Kaufman Academic Chair of Cardiology, Sentara Health. "The REVEAL Lite 2.0 risk score provides a powerful, non-invasive way to track disease trajectory. Previous REVEAL Lite 2.0 validation showed that a 1-point score improvement reduces risk of mortality by 23% and reduces the risk of clinical worsening by 21%. Here we saw that patients on TPIP averaged a greater than 1-point improvement from baseline, which is really meaningful for patients. Sustained improvements of this magnitude, alongside gains in exercise capacity and Functional Class, provide a strong clinical rationale to advance this therapy into Phase 3 development." Results for the primary endpoint of safety & tolerability showed that once-daily TPIP therapy was generally well tolerated with no newly identified safety signals at doses up to 1,280 µg through Month 12. Of the 91 patients in the study, treatment-emergent adverse events (TEAEs) occurred in 89.0% of patients; serious TEAEs were observed in 18.7% of patients; and severe TEAEs were observed in 16.5% of patients in the study. TEAEs leading to study discontinuation were experienced by 7.7% of patients. There were four deaths, none of which were considered related to TPIP treatment. The most common TEAEs through Month 12 occurring in 5.0% or more of all patients were headache (28.6%), cough (15.4%), nasopharyngitis (14.3%), diarrhea (11.0%), upper respiratory tract infection (9.9%), bronchitis (7.7%), dizziness (6.6%), epistaxis (6.6%), nausea (6.6%), anemia (5.5%), influenza (5.5%), and pneumonia (5.5%). The 12-Month OLE findings support the continued clinical development of TPIP and the recent initiation of PALM-PAH, a Phase 3,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led trial evaluating once-daily TPIP in patients with PAH over 24 weeks. The primary endpoint of PALM-PAH is change in 6MWD, with additional assessments of safety, tolerability, and overall efficacy. About TPIP Treprostinil palmitil inhalation powder (TPIP) is a dry powder formulation of treprostinil palmitil, a treprostinil prodrug consisting of treprostinil linked by an ester bond to a 16-carbon chain. Developed entirely in Insmed's laboratories, TPIP is a potentially highly differentiated prostanoid being evaluated as a once-daily therapy for the treatment of patients with PAH, pulmonary hypertension associated with interstitial lung disease (PH-ILD), progressive pulmonary fibrosis (PPF), and id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is (IPF). TPIP is administered in a capsule-based inhalation device. TPIP is an investigational drug product that has not been approved for any indication in any jurisdiction. About the TPIP Open-Label Extension Study The 24-month open-label extension (OLE) study of treprostinil palmitil inhalation powder (TPIP) in pat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H) was designed to evaluate the long-term safety, tolerability, and effectiveness of TPIP administered once daily in patients who completed the lead-in TPIP PAH studies. The OLE is being conducted at 45 sites globally and enrolled 91 eligible patients. The study included a 3-week blinded titration period followed by open-label treatment. Patients who received TPIP in the lead-in studies (TPIP Continued) received their achieved dose of TPIP; patients who received placebo in the lead-in studies (Placebo Crossed), or had delayed rollover, underwent titration starting at 80 µg once daily up to their target dose (i.e., 640 µg or highest tolerated dose) over three weeks. Further escalation up to 1,280 µg was permitted after the initial titration period at investigator discretion to optimize clinical benefit. Outcomes were evaluated against the Phase 2b lead-in study in PAH (NCT05147805) pre-randomization baseline values for relevant measurements. The primary endpoint is evaluating long-term safety and tolerability, including treatment-emergent adverse events (TEAEs) and TEAEs by severity. Secondary endpoints include change from lead-in study pre-randomization baseline in six-minute walk distance (6MWD), N-terminal fragment pro-B-type natriuretic peptide (NT-proBNP) concentration, World Health Organization (WHO) Functional Class, REVEAL Lite 2.0 score, and additional exploratory measures over 24 months of treatment. About Pulmonary Arterial Hypertension P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H) is a serious, progressive, rare disease in which the blood vessels in the lungs narrow or become obstructed, leading to high blood pressure in the pulmonary arteries. The most common symptoms include shortness of breath, chest pain, dizziness or fainting, fatigue, and weakness. It is estimated that approximately 35,000 patients in the U.S., 40,000 patients in the EU5 (France, Germany, Italy, Spain, and the UK), and 15,000 patients in Japan have been diagnosed with the disease. Untreated PAH can be debilitating and often fatal. This post may contain links from our sponsors and affiliates, and Flywheel Publishing may receive compensation for actions taken through them.AI data center construction is a power problem before it is a compute problem, and the equipment that moves, conditions, cools and backs up electricity inside those buildings is where the earnings leverage is showing up first. Three U.S.-listed industrials have become the cleanest ways to own that buildout: Eaton (NYSE:ETN | ETN Price Prediction) for switchgear and thermal management, Vertiv (NYSE:VRT) for critical power and cooling infrastructure and Caterpillar (NYSE:CAT) for on-site backup generation. Each posted a first-quarter beat, each raised guidance, and each is trading with a forward multiple that reflects real order acceleration rather than a story. Here is how they stack up going into the July earnings cycle. The macro backdrop is unusually supportive. The Department of Energy projects data centers will account for up to 12% of U.S. electrical demand by 2028, and PJM Interconnection’s independent market monitor concluded that “data center load growth is the primary reason for recent and expected capacity market conditions” in the country’s largest grid region. That is the tailwind these three names are monetizing. Eaton (ETN): The Compounding Acquirer Eaton makes the electrical guts of a data center: switchgear, busway, power distribution and now liquid cooling after closing Boyd Thermal. Shares traded around $413.98 on July 15, up 26.48% year to date, with a market cap near $158 billion. Forward earnings sits at 30x and the analyst consensus target at $455.79, with 22 Buy or Strong Buy ratings against four Hold ratings. Q1 delivered adjusted EPS of $2.81 versus a $2.73 consensus on revenue of $7.45 billion, up 16.8% year over year. The number to anchor on is Electrical Americas: revenue rose 20% while the twelve-month rolling order book grew 42% organically, driven by data center demand. Total Electrical backlog is up 48%. Management closed $11 billion in acquisitions in the quarter, headlined by Boyd Thermal at $9.55 billion, and raised full-year adjusted EPS guidance to $13.05 to $13.50. CEO Paulo Ruiz called out “significant capacity expansion investments to meet demand” in Electrical Americas. Risk: integration. Net interest expense jumped to $106 million from $33 million year over year, and GAAP EPS fell to $2.22 from $2.45 on acquisition charges. A stumble on Boyd or the planned Q1 2027 Mobility spin-off would compress the multiple quickly. Vertiv (VRT): The High-Growth Pure Play Vertiv is the closest thing to a listed data-center-infrastructure pure play. On July 15, shares changed hands around $300.86, up more than 71% year to date and more than 136% over the past year. Silver FAQs Silver is a precious metal highly traded among investors. It has been historically used as a store of value and a medium of exchange. Although less popular than Gold, traders may turn to Silver to diversify their investment portfolio, for its intrinsic value or as a potential hedge during high-inflation periods. Investors can buy physical Silver, in coins or in bars, or trade it through vehicles such as Exchange Traded Funds, which track its price on international markets. Silver prices can move due to a wide range of factors. Geopolitical instability or fears of a deep recession can make Silver price escalate due to its safe-haven status, although to a lesser extent than Gold's. As a yieldless asset, Silver tends to rise with lower interest rates. Its moves also depend on how the US Dollar (USD) behaves as the asset is priced in dollars (XAG/USD). A strong Dollar tends to keep the price of Silver at bay, whereas a weaker Dollar is likely to propel prices up. Other factors such as investment demand, mining supply – Silver is much more abundant than Gold – and recycling rates can also affect prices. Silver is widely used in industry, particularly in sectors such as electronics or solar energy, as it has one of the highest electric conductivity of all metals – more than Copper and Gold. A surge in demand can increase prices, while a decline tends to lower them. Dynamics in the US, Chinese and Indian economies can also contribute to price swings: for the US and particularly China, their big industrial sectors use Silver in various processes; in India, consumers’ demand for the precious metal for jewellery also plays a key role in setting prices. Silver prices tend to follow Gold's moves. When Gold prices rise, Silver typically follows suit, as their status as safe-haven assets is similar. The Gold/Silver ratio, which shows the number of ounces of Silver needed to equal the value of one ounce of Gold, may help to determine the relative valuation between both metals. Some investors may consider a high ratio as an indicator that Silver is undervalued, or Gold is overvalued. On the contrary, a low ratio might suggest that Gold is undervalued relative to Silver. |

Summary:The EUR/TRY pair is testing a major 54.00 resistance level, a psychological barrier that previously triggered a significant technical rejection of the euro Persistent double-digit inflation and high energy import costs continue to structurally weaken the Turkish lira against the euro’s ongoing upward momentum Traders are awaiting the July 23 central bank policy meeting, where any unexpected hawkish signals could spark a sharp rally in the lira The euro has regained some ground against the Turkish lira after a period of decline in late June. The pair is currently trading near the 54.00 level, which has previously acted as a resistance point. This technical level raises questions about the potential for further advances and the continuation of the broader upward trend. Why the Lira Keeps Losing Ground Several factors are contributing to the lira’s continued depreciation. Turkey is experiencing persistent high inflation, with the annual rate at 32.11% in June, a slight decrease from 32.61% in May. This figure remains significantly above the central bank’s medium-term objectives. The Central Bank of the Republic of Turkey (CBRT) has maintained its policy rate at 37% for three consecutive meetings. This pause followed an aggressive easing cycle, which was complicated by rising energy prices due to Middle East conflict, impacting the path to lower inflation. Turkey relies heavily on imported energy, so when Brent crude oil prices jump, it puts a strain on the country’s trade balance. This forces local businesses to keep selling lira to buy foreign currency to pay for fuel. Governor Fatih Karahan has clearly stated that the bank needs to see more solid proof of inflation slowing down and better clarity on the geopolitical situation before they start cutting rates again. The next policy meeting is on July 23. Until then, the central bank’s message is basically wait and see. Can the EUR/TRY Pair Break 54.00? Regarding the potential for the EUR/TRY pair to break above 54.00, the underlying macroeconomic conditions have not substantially changed, suggesting a continued test of recent highs. Analysts describe the lira’s depreciation as a managed, gradual movement rather than a sharp devaluation. The CBRT has intervened periodically to moderate volatility without reversing the overall trend. This approach typically results in incremental movements toward resistance levels, which is consistent with the pair’s two previous attempts at the 54.00 mark. For a decisive break, we’d probably need one of a fresh worsening of Turkish inflation expectations, a hawkish surprise from the ECB, or renewed geopolitical escalation pushing energy prices even higher. Without one of those catalysts, the pair might just keep consolidating right below that barrier. If the EUR/TRY fails to break past this barrier over the next few sessions, a technical double-top pattern could emerge. This would likely trigger quick profit-taking by short-term momentum traders, potentially sending the pair sliding back down to test support at 53.50 and 53.12. The Euro is also fighting its own battle. Softening economic growth indicators in the Eurozone or a shift by the ECB towards a more aggressive rate-cutting cycle could diminish the euro’s inherent buying support, thereby capping upside potential for the EUR/TRY. Why is EUR/TRY struggling near 54.00? This level marked a prior rejection point, and with no fresh catalyst yet, the pair is consolidating there rather than breaking through decisively. Where does the Central Bank of the Republic of Turkey’s primary benchmark one-week repo rate currently sit? The Monetary Policy Committee of the Central Bank of the Republic of Turkey has held its key one-week repo interest rate at 37%. Why does a rise in global oil prices structurally weaken the Turkish lira against major foreign currencies? Turkey imports nearly all its energy. Therefore, surging oil costs widen its trade deficit by forcing domestic firms to sell lira for foreign currencies. |

Apollo Global Management's (APO +1.58%) stock price is down about 15% in recent weeks. The decline is mainly tied to the annual reconstitution of the Russell indexes. Apollo, an alternative asset manager, was removed from the Russell 1000 Growth Index following the latest reconstitution, which took effect on June 26.In the algorithms that Russell uses to reconstitute its various indexes, Apollo no longer exhibited the traits of a growth stock. Instead, it was deemed a value stock and was moved into the Russell 1000 Value Index. Right after the rebalancing took effect, Apolloʻs stock price dropped sharply and is now trading at roughly $120 per share, off 18% year to date. But is this an opportunity to buy low on this growth-turned-value stock? Image source: Getty Images. Growth to value A big reason Apollo stock dropped is that it got kicked out of two massive growth exchange-traded funds (ETFs) -- the $127 billion iShares Russell 1000 Growth ETF (IWF +0.28%) and the $44 billion Vanguard Russell 1000 Growth ETF (VONG +0.26%). Losing invested capital from these sizeable funds, literally overnight, can leave a big dent in the stock price. It did get added to two value ETFs -- the $81 billion iShares Russell 1000 Value ETF (IWD +0.37%) and the $20 billion Vanguard Russell 1000 Value ETF (VONV +0.47%). But combined, these two ETFs have almost $75 billion less in assets to invest than the two growth ETFs. That aside, Apollo Global still has strong fundamentals, and this rebalancing could present an excellent buying opportunity. Showtime for Apollo? Apollo stock looks like a good buy right now, with some momentum following a strong first quarter. As an alternative asset manager, it invests in private equity, private debt, and other alternative investments. These assets tend to have a low correlation to stocks, often performing well when stocks don't -- like they did in the first quarter. Today's Change ( 1.58 %) $ 1.90 Current Price $ 121.83 In Q1, Apollo had record fee-related income of $728 million, up 30% year over year, while adjusted net income rose 8% to $1.2 billion. Wall Street analysts project 21% revenue growth in 2026 and 14% growth in 2027. Earnings are expected to rise 6% this year and another 20% in 2027. One concern that contributed to the sell-off was a June 22 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) filing that said Apollo was capping redemptions at 5%. This was most likely due to high redemption requests to its flagship fund, Apollo Debt Solutions, totalling 16.8% of the fund. This was sparked by heightened concerns among investors about problems in the private credit market. It's the second quarter in a row that they've put redemption caps in place. While private credit has been resilient, it is something to watch. Apollo is a good value on a forward earnings basis Apollo's price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io is high, but that's because it took GAAP (generally accepted accounting principles) losses last quarter due to a high one-time offshore tax-related expense. But on a forward earnings basis, it is relatively cheap, trading at 13 times forward earnings. Some 73% of Wall Street analysts rate it as a buy, with a median price target of $150 per share. That would suggest 25% upside. I think reconstitution will benefit investors, as they can now get this value stock at a discount. |

For clients actively trading digital assets, the ability to use USDC as good segregated collateral will enhance capital efficiencies and set the stage for a new wave of innovation.” The launch of this service follows the issuance of a no-action letter from the Commodities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) in December 2025, on the use of digital assets as collateral. The letter effectively permits Futures Commission Merchants (FCMs) to accept non-securities digital assets, including USDC, Bitcoin and Ethereum, as customer margin collateral for CFTC-regulated derivatives and to treat them in certain risk calculations, subject to strict conditions. Coinbase supports Marex’s implementation through NYDFS-qualified custody, 1:1 instant fiat-to-USDC conversion, and bespoke reporting infrastructure aligned with CME requirements. The integration of USDC marks a significant step toward modernizing global derivatives market infrastructure. In today’s markets, risk moves in response to global events as they unfold, yet collateral relies on traditional banking rails constrained by operating hours and multi-day settlement. The ability to post USDC as initial margin empowers Marex clients to manage risk in near real time, moving collateral 24/7 at internet-speed to keep pace with always-on markets. Over time, as the use of tokenized collateral becomes more prevalent, its real-time mobility and transparency can help drive down risks across the system. “USDC, when integrated into institutional trading and clearing workflows, enables initial margin to move at internet speed, unlocking new levels of efficiency and programmability in collateral management all while meeting the rigorous standards institutional markets demand,” said Claire Ching, VP of Global Capital Markets at Circle. “By supporting USDC as IM collateral, Marex is equipping institutional trading clients to operate seamlessly in a 24/7 global market environment.” “Stablecoin collateral is moving from concept to production. Key Takeaways Decentralized trading platform Ostium on Arbitrum suffered a security breach resulting in losses between $18 and $22 million. The perpetrator exploited the platform’s oracle mechanism by submitting price data with falsified future timestamps. Fraudulent trades appeared profitable due to the manipulation, causing the liquidity vault to dispense $18 million in USDC. All trading activity has been suspended as Ostium conducts a thorough investigation, with users advised to revoke smart contract permissions. This incident continues a troubling trend of oracle-related vulnerabilities affecting DeFi platforms in 2025 and 2026. On July 15, Ostium—a decentralized perpetual futures platform operating on Arbitrum—suspended all trading operations following a sophisticated attack that resulted in approximately $18 million in USDC being withdrawn from its liquidity reserves.RWA Perpetual Protocol Ostium Suffers Suspected $18 Million Exploit on Arbitrum Security firm Blockaid said it detected an exploit involving Ostium Vault on Arbitrum. According to Blockaid, the attacker used a registered PriceUpKeep forwarder and future-dated authorized oracle… pic.twitter.com/2DfIGrRIoR — Wu Blockchain (@WuBlockchain) July 15, 2026 Multiple blockchain security organizations, including Blockaid and CertiK, detected and reported the breach. While Blockaid assessed the damage at approximately $18 million, CertiK’s analysis suggested the total could reach $22 million. Ostium’s team has acknowledged the incident but has yet to release official loss figures pending their ongoing investigation. The vulnerability exploited in this attack centered on Ostium’s oracle infrastructure—the critical system responsible for feeding external market price information to the decentralized platform. Blockaid’s analysis revealed that the attacker leveraged a legitimate component within Ostium’s automated pricing mechanism known as the PriceUpKeep forwarder. This module functions as the gateway for transmitting real-time asset valuations onto the blockchain during trade execution. The malicious actor submitted oracle price updates containing fabricated timestamps set to future dates. This temporal manipulation caused unprofitable positions to register as successful trades, subsequently prompting the vault’s smart contract to release approximately $18 million in USDC. In a statement shared on X, Ostium announced the immediate suspension of trading following the detection of irregularities in its vault system. The platform emphasized user protection, stating: “With user security being our first concern, we recommend that all users temporarily revoke approvals for our contracts until we can further investigate the recent incident.” Technical Details of the Oracle Breach Ostium’s pricing infrastructure relies on Gelato, an external automation service, to deliver real-world asset valuation data to the blockchain. The PriceUpKeep smart contract serves as the central mechanism coordinating these price refresh operations. The attacker successfully obtained access to an authorized position within this framework, enabling them to introduce counterfeit pricing information with incorrect timing parameters. This manipulation deceived the protocol into validating false profitable positions, triggering unauthorized fund releases from the treasury. The platform facilitates leveraged trading across multiple asset classes including commodities, foreign exchange, stock indices, and digital currencies, offering leverage ratios up to 200x with settlements denominated in USDC. Rising Trend of Oracle-Based Exploits This security breach occurred merely one week after Summer.fi experienced a similar attack methodology that resulted in $6 million in stolen funds. Cybersecurity experts note an emerging pattern where malicious actors increasingly focus on exploiting offchain infrastructure components like oracle systems rather than targeting smart contract vulnerabilities directly. According to data compiled by DeFiLlama, cryptocurrency-related hacking incidents generated losses approaching $630 million during April alone—marking the highest single-month total since February 2025. Decentralized finance protocols bore the majority of these losses. Prior to this exploit, Ostium had secured $27.8 million in total capital, including a substantial $24 million Series A funding round jointly led by General Catalyst and Jump Crypto in late 2025. The platform had facilitated more than $50 billion in aggregate trading volume before the security incident. JPMorgan research analysts noted in April that infrastructure and bridge security vulnerabilities continue to represent significant obstacles for DeFi’s progression toward mainstream institutional acceptance. Economic Indicator Retail Sales (MoM) The Retail Sales data, released by the US Census Bureau on a monthly basis, measures the value in total receipts of retail and food stores in the United States. Monthly percent changes reflect the rate of changes in such sales. A stratified random sampling method is used to select approximately 4,800 retail and food services firms whose sales are then weighted and benchmarked to represent the complete universe of over three million retail and food services firms across the country. The data is adjusted for seasonal variations as well as holiday and trading-day differences, but not for price changes. Retail Sales data is widely followed as an indicator of consumer spending, which is a major driver of the US economy. Generally, a high reading is seen as bullish for the US Dollar (USD), while a low reading is seen as bearish. Read more. Next release: Thu Jul 16, 2026 12:30 Frequency: Monthly Consensus: 0.2% Previous: 0.9% Source: US Census Bureau Retail Sales data published by the US Census Bureau is a leading indicator that gives important information about consumer spending, which has a significant impact on the GDP. Although strong sales figures are likely to boost the USD, external factors, such as weather conditions, could distort the data and paint a misleading picture. In addition to the headline data, changes in the Retail Sales Control Group could trigger a market reaction as it is used to prepare the estimates of Personal Consumption Expenditures for most goods. |

(The technical analysis of this story was written with the help of an AI tool. Know more.) Inflation FAQs Inflation measures the rise in the price of a representative basket of goods and services. Headline inflation is usually expressed as a percentage change on a month-on-month (MoM) and year-on-year (YoY) basis. Core inflation excludes more volatile elements such as food and fuel which can fluctuate because of geopolitical and seasonal factors. Core inflation is the figure economists focus on and is the level targeted by central banks, which are mandated to keep inflation at a manageable level, usually around 2%. The Consumer Price Index (CPI) measures the change in prices of a basket of goods and services over a period of time. It is usually expressed as a percentage change on a month-on-month (MoM) and year-on-year (YoY) basis. Core CPI is the figure targeted by central banks as it excludes volatile food and fuel inputs. When Core CPI rises above 2% it usually results in higher interest rates and vice versa when it falls below 2%. Since higher interest rates are positive for a currency, higher inflation usually results in a stronger currency. The opposite is true when inflation falls. Although it may seem counter-intuitive, high inflation in a country pushes up the value of its currency and vice versa for lower inflation. This is because the central bank will normally raise interest rates to combat the higher inflation, which attract more global capital inflows from investors looking for a lucrative place to park their money. Formerly, Gold was the asset investors turned to in times of high inflation because it preserved its value, and whilst investors will often still buy Gold for its safe-haven properties in times of extreme market turmoil, this is not the case most of the time. This is because when inflation is high, central banks will put up interest rates to combat it. Higher interest rates are negative for Gold because they increase the opportunity-cost of holding Gold vis-a-vis an interest-bearing asset or placing the money in a cash deposit account. On the flipside, lower inflation tends to be positive for Gold as it brings interest rates down, making the bright metal a more viable investment alternative. |

A Bitcoin wallet that had remained inactive for more than eight years has transferred 5,908 BTC worth about $383 million, reviving another long-dormant holding as traders continue tracking large onchain movements.Summary A Bitcoin wallet dormant for more than eight years transferred 5,908 BTC worth about $383 million to a new address. Onchain data showed the coins were not sent to a known exchange wallet, leaving the holder’s intentions unclear. The transfer followed another dormant whale move earlier this week, keeping large Bitcoin wallet activity in focus. According to blockchain analytics platform Lookonchain, citing Arkham data, the wallet identified as “138EM…ReyiT” moved the entire 5,908 BTC balance to a new address at 7:15 p.m. ET on Wednesday. The coins remain in the recipient wallet, with no signs that they have been sent to a cryptocurrency exchange. Arkham’s data showed the wallet originally received the Bitcoin in December 2017, when BTC traded near $16,800. The holdings were worth about $99.6 million at the time, compared with roughly $383 million at current market prices. The timing of the original purchase makes the wallet notable. The holder kept the coins through Bitcoin’s nearly 80% decline in 2018, its rally to almost $69,000 in 2021, the subsequent fall to around $15,500 in late 2022, and the record high above $122,000 reached in October 2025, according to market price data. At that peak, the wallet’s balance was worth about $726 million. While the movement has drawn attention, CoinDesk’s onchain analysis said the Bitcoin was transferred to a newly created, unlabeled address rather than a known exchange deposit address, indicating there is no onchain evidence of an immediate public sale. The report also noted that the coins moved from a legacy Bitcoin address beginning with “1” to a newer SegWit address beginning with “bc1q.” According to CoinDesk, large holders often reorganize assets to upgrade wallet formats, improve custody, rotate private keys, prepare estate transfers, or arrange over-the-counter transactions that do not reach public exchanges. Dormant whale activity remains in focus The latest transfer follows another dormant Bitcoin wallet that became active earlier this week after more than seven years. As previously reported by crypto.news, blockchain intelligence platform Arkham said a wallet moved 2,931 BTC worth about $188 million to a new address after remaining inactive since Bitcoin traded near $6,500. Although neither transfer has confirmed selling activity, CryptoQuant has reported that whale-sized deposits continue to dominate Bitcoin exchange inflows. Its exchange whale ratio recently stood at 0.99, indicating that the 10 largest transfers accounted for nearly all Bitcoin deposited to exchanges. According to the firm, elevated readings have historically been associated with higher selling pressure because large deposits are more likely to precede sizable sales. |
